We're going to the Yacht Club this weekend and I plan on buying APs for my family. We plan on going to Epcot on Saturday morning, first park of the trip. Is the International Gateway open to buy tickets or do I need to go around to the front entrance?

Yes, there is a ticket window at the International Gateway. You can buy your ticket there. It usually does not have much of a line, if any.

We did have to wait until about 9:15 before they would let us get into the park proper (we were through the turnstiles, but were roped off by the bridge between UK and France) I don't know if that day the main entrance opened late or not, but by the time we had got round to Soarin' the line was 90mins, and the earliest fast pass was 6pm!! This was on Nov 11th.
